Wood Products 

Daily Care

  • Hand wash with warm, soapy water immediately after use
  • Rinse thoroughly and dry completely with a clean lint-free towel
  • DO NOT SUBMERGE in water
  • Never soak or put in the dishwasher
  • Avoid harsh detergents

Maintenance

  • Oil monthly with food-grade mineral oil or specialized wood conditioner
  • Apply oil when wood appears dry or light-colored
  • Allow oil to penetrate for several hours or overnight, then wipe excess
  • Well-maintained wood products can last decades

What to Avoid

  • Dishwashers, microwaves, or prolonged soaking
  • Extreme temperature changes
  • Direct sunlight for extended periods
  • Cutting citrus directly on the surface (use a barrier)
  • Cutting directly on your engraved design. Flip board over and use the unengraved side for serving/cutting. 

Marble Products  

Daily Care

  • Wipe clean with a damp lint-free cloth and mild soap
  • Dry immediately to prevent water spots
  • DO NOT SUBMERGE in water
  • Never soak or put in the dishwasher
  • Avoid harsh detergents

Maintenance

  • Polish occasionally with marble-specific polish
  • Address spills immediately to prevent etching

What to Avoid

  • Acidic substances (citrus, wine, vinegar, tomatoes)
  • Abrasive cleaners or scrubbing pads
  • Generic household cleaners
  • Dishwashers, microwaves, or prolonged soaking
  • Extreme temperature changes
  • Direct sunlight for extended periods
  • Cutting citrus directly on the surface (use a barrier)
  • Cutting directly on your engraved design. Flip board over and use the unengraved side for serving/cutting. 

Slate Products

Daily Care

  • Wipe with a damp cloth and mild detergent
  • Dry thoroughly to prevent water marks
  • Hand wash only

Maintenance

  • Apply food-safe slate sealer annually if using for food service
  • Store in a dry location to prevent moisture damage
  • Handle carefully to avoid chipping edges

What to Avoid

  • Dishwashers or soaking
  • Abrasive cleaners or steel wool
  • Dropping or impact with hard surfaces
  • Extreme temperature changes

Glass Products

Daily Care

  • Hand wash in warm soapy water when possible
  • For dishwasher use, place securely in top rack only. Please check product description to determine if item is dishwasher safe or not. 
  • Avoid sudden temperature changes
  • Dry with a lint-free cloth to prevent water spots

Deep Cleaning

  • For hard water stains, soak in white vinegar solution
  • Use baking soda paste for stubborn residue
  • Rinse thoroughly and air dry or hand dry

Maintenance

  • Inspect regularly for chips or cracks
  • Store carefully with adequate spacing
  • Use appropriate storage racks or padding

What to Avoid

  • Extreme temperature changes (hot glass in cold water)
  • Abrasive scrubbers or harsh chemicals
  • Overcrowding in dishwasher
  • Freezer storage (unless specifically designed for it)


Leather Products


Daily Care

  • Wipe with a clean, dry lint-free cloth to remove surface dirt
  • Allow to air dry if wet - never use direct heat
  • Rotate use if you have multiple leather items

Deep Cleaning

  • Use leather-specific cleaner for stains
  • Apply cleaner to a cloth first, then to leather
  • Always test cleaning products on an inconspicuous area first
  • Allow to dry naturally away from direct heat or sunlight

Maintenance

  • Condition every 3-6 months with quality leather conditioner
  • Apply conditioner sparingly with a soft cloth
  • Buff gently after conditioning
  • Store in a cool, dry place with good air circulation

What to Avoid

  • Water saturation or soaking
  • Direct heat sources (radiators, hair dryers)
  • Harsh chemicals or household cleaners
  • Direct sunlight for extended periods
  • Sharp objects that could scratch or puncture

Ceramic Products

Daily Care

  • Hand wash or use dishwasher on normal cycle. Please check product description to determine if dishwasher safe or not. 
  • Check manufacturer recommendations for microwave safety. Check product description to determine if microwave safe or not. 
  • Avoid extreme temperature changes
  • Handle carefully to prevent chipping

Deep Cleaning

  • For coffee or tea stains, use baking soda paste or denture cleaning tablets
  • Soak stubborn stains overnight in warm soapy water
  • Use soft brush for textured surfaces

Maintenance

  • Inspect regularly for chips or cracks that could harbor bacteria
  • Replace damaged items promptly
  • Store carefully to prevent impact damage

What to Avoid

  • Sudden temperature changes (very hot liquid in cold mug)
  • Abrasive cleaners on decorated surfaces
  • Microwave use if not microwave-safe
  • Dropping or banging against hard surfaces


General Storage Tips

  • Store all items in a clean, dry environment
  • Avoid stacking heavy items on delicate materials
  • Keep different materials separated to prevent scratching
  • Ensure items are completely dry before storage
  • Use protective padding for valuable or delicate pieces
